1 Safety Follow these safety instructions when using the accessory. This product complies with the regulations for products that come into contact with food. ¡ The cookware is not suitable for use in the microwave. ¡ The cookware was developed for domestic use only. ¡ The cookware is intended for cooking. ¡ Do not store food in the cookware for an extended period of time. ¡ Do not change the cookware in any way. ¡ Never leave the cookware unattended when cooking. ¡ Never leave children unattended near hot cookware. ¡ The water that is added must never cover the safety valve in the water reservoir. ¡ Do not press the coffee powder in the basket. Otherwise, the pressure is too great. ¡ When making espresso, turn the espresso maker so that the safety valve is not pointing towards the body. ¡ Regularly check the safety valve and the basket. The safety valve and the basket must not be clogged with coffee. WARNING‒Risk of burns! The handles and lid may become very hot. ▶ Always use oven gloves. ▶ Leave the cookware to cool down before cleaning it. WARNING‒Risk of scalding! Hot liquid, splashes and steam may cause scalding. ▶ Do not fill liquid higher than the maximum capacity mark. ATTENTION! Improper use may damage the cookware or the hob. ▶ Never heat cookware when it is empty. ▶ Never leave empty cookware on the heat.en Scope of delivery Scope of delivery 2 Scope of delivery Scope of delivery After unpacking all parts, check for any damage in transit and complete- ness of the delivery.

Incorrect assembly or improper use of the espresso maker may lead to water or steam escaping. ▶ Completely seal the espresso maker. ▶ When making espresso, turn the espresso maker so that the safety valve is not pointing towards the body. ▶ Avoid excessive heat which may cause the water in the espresso maker to spray out. ▶ If the water in the espresso maker is spraying out and sounds can be heard, reduce the power level. Fault Cause and troubleshooting Water or steam ap- pears between the water reservoir and the upper part of the espresso maker. The espresso powder is ground too finely. ▶ Remove the espresso maker from the cooking sur- face immediately. ▶ Use medium-coarsely ground espresso powder. Espresso powder that is ground too finely may clog the filters and prevent the steam from rising into the upper part. The espresso maker is not completely sealed. ▶ Remove the espresso maker from the cooking sur- face immediately. ▶ Completely seal the espresso maker.

  • "Using the cookware", Page10 Water or steam come from the safety valve. The espresso powder is ground too finely. ▶ Remove the espresso maker from the cooking sur- face immediately. ▶ Use medium-coarsely ground espresso powder. Espresso powder that is ground too finely may clog the filters and prevent the steam from rising into the upper part. The power level is set too high. ▶ Remove the espresso maker from the cooking sur- face immediately. ▶ Use a medium power setting. The coffee tastes bit- ter. The espresso powder is ground too finely. ▶ Use medium-coarsely ground espresso powder. Espresso powder that is ground too finely may clog the filters and prevent the steam from rising into the upper part. All of the water has evaporated.Troubleshooting en

Fault Cause and troubleshooting The coffee tastes bit- ter. ▶ Remove the espresso maker from the cooking sur- face at an earlier point. The water in the water reservoir is too cold. ▶ Fill the water reservoir with pre-heated water. The power level is set too high. ▶ Use a lower power level.en Warranty
